Output 2e1821e8add152b4e8f33f82924b04b0306493affb2a443174de866ef253da5c:1

value
27868987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b07ea1b7c24d69811c9da52ba91d839db33662e9 OP_EQUAL
address
3HnEYqB1uMNChPPiyLYj9SkBDmeqzoC7u4
transaction
2e1821e8add152b4e8f33f82924b04b0306493affb2a443174de866ef253da5c
spent
true